Which is the BEST example of showing agency in one’s education? A. making friends while getting your education B. taking the req

uired courses and nothing more C. actively looking for new opportunities to build skills D. doing exactly what an advisor or other agent suggests

The best example of showing agency in one’s education is: C. actively looking for new opportunities to build skills.

<h3>What is an agency?</h3>

An agency can be defined as the ability of an individual to identify valued goals, priorities and desired outcomes, so as to enhance the purposeful pursuit of those goals and desired outcomes proactively, efficiently and effectively.

In this context, we can infer and logically conclude that actively looking for new opportunities to build skills is the best example of showing agency in one’s education.

You will be asked to provide all of the following personal information as part of your college application except:

Answer:

B. Your religious affiliation

Explanation:

The first part of your college application process includes providing your personal information. The basic information should include your:

  • Name
  • Social security number
  • Current address
  • Permanent address
  • Telephone number
  • Email address
  • Birth date
  • Citizenship
  • Sex or gender
  • Ethnic affiliation
  • Parent or guardian contact information

Answering questions about your sex or gender and ethnic affiliation is usually optional and does not affect your application process. You will not be asked to provide information about your religious affiliation at all.
